About
Dr. Jafar Massaj is a pioneering researcher at the intersection of agricultural engineering and artificial intelligence, whose work is transforming precision farming. His core research areas include agricultural robotics, machine vision, and intelligent systems for crop management. Dr. Massaj’s most significant contributions lie in developing autonomous robots for specialized agricultural tasks, from nitrogen fertilizing management (82 citations) to intelligent spraying based on plant bulk volume (53 citations) and robotic yield estimation for kiwifruit (50 citations). He is also a leader in applying artificial neural networks to plant health, creating systems that identify fungal diseases in cucumber (49 citations) and detect insect pests in field crops (42 citations) using digital image processing. His work extends to robotic pruning, hedge trimming, and the mechanical design of harvesters for date fruit—a particularly dangerous task for human laborers. With a portfolio of highly cited papers spanning a decade, Dr. Massaj has established himself as a key figure in smart agriculture, demonstrating how robotics and AI can enhance efficiency, reduce human risk, and enable data-driven decision-making in farming.
